Domino Harvey was a bounty hunter in the United States. She came from a well-to-do background, being the daughter of Laurence Harvey and Paulene Stone.

Harvey’s fame was increased posthumously by the 2005 release of the film Domino, which was loosely based on her life, in which Harvey was portrayed by Keira Knightley.

In 2003, Harvey was arrested on charges of possession of crystal methamphetamine after sheriff’s deputies found the drug at her home while investigating a burglar alarm call out.

Harvey continually denied that she was a drug trafficker, claiming to have been set up. While under house arrest, she lived with a person whom she had hired as a sober guardian to help her refrain from drug use.
On the night of June 27, 2005, her aide discovered her unconscious in her bath. She was taken to a hospital but could not be resuscitated.
